Fetus
A prenatal human between the embryonic state and birth.
Ectoderm
The outermost layer of cells in the early embryo, giving rise to structures such as the skin, nails, and hair, as well as the nervous system.
Inner Cell Mass
A group of cells inside the early embryo that will eventually develop into the body of the organism.
Digestive System
The complex series of organs and glands responsible for the breakdown, digestion, and absorption of nutrients from food into the body.
